Chapter 1 & 3 Review Chemistry 312
Which of the following measurements would be affected by altitude? Weight or Mass
Which of the following would not be considered matter: A. atoms B. heat C. alloys D. pudding
After extensive experimentation what end result of the scientific method offers an explanation of what occurs in nature. A Law or a Theory
Which of the following properties couldn’t you describe quantitatively: Temperature Time Pressure Color
What type of matter does jello represent: a. element b. compound c. heterogeneous mixture d. homogeneous mixture
What type of matter does Copper I chloride (CuCl) represent: a. element b. compound c. heterogeneous mixture d. homogeneous mixture
What type of matter does this granite represent: a. element b. compound c. heterogeneous mixture d. homogeneous mixture

The observation of this property of matter is always accompanied by a change in the composition of matter? Physical or Chemical
What type of change is represented by the freezing of water to form ice? Physical or Chemical
Which of the following is not a physical property? Temperature Ability to dissolve Color Ability to rust
Which of the following types of matter can be separated by physical change? Elements Compounds Mixtures
A solution is another name for: element compound homogeneous mixture heterogeneous mixture
What type of matter is oxygen (O2)? element compound homogeneous mixture heterogeneous mixture
What separtation technique would be used to separate a heterogeneous mixture containing a solid and a liquid? distillation chromatography filtration crystallization
What separtation technique would be used to separate a homogeneous mixture containing a solid and a liquid? distillation chromatography filtration crystallization
What technique uses the physical property of boiling point to separate components of a mixture? distillation chromatography filtration crystallization
What type of reaction is associated with the absorption of energy? Exothermic or Endothermic
According to the Law of Conservation of Mass, what must the mass of CO2 be in the following equation? C6H12O6+ 6O2 6CO2 + 6H2O 54g + 98g = _____ + 53g
Which of the following is not an indication of a chemical change? formation of a gas change in color formation of a precipitate melting
